Rev. David Glusker, retired elder in the New England Conference, shares the following about a nine-day mission opportunity in Guatemala.
 
Salud y Paz is a ministry of healthcare and education in the mountains of Guatemala. Several groups of United Methodists from New England have been going to assist this ministry during recent years. 

Having spent a month in Guatemala for each of the past five years, and having brought small “mission teams” for a nine-day experience during the past two years, I am delighted to offer an invitation to other members of the Conference to participate in our third mission trip to Guatemala. 
 
The trip will begin on Oct. 7, 2017, when the group will fly out from Boston to work with the staff of Salud y Paz mission doing what needs to be done for the Mayan people in the mountain area of Guatemala.

The cost of the trip will be $1,500 to $2,000. That includes travel, hotels in Guatemala, almost all meals, a staff member "shepherding" us, and a contribution to the mission. 

Five of people are already committed to go this year; we can accommodate up to 20 (although 15 might be a better number).
